85.38 percent of the population in 20106 drive to work alone. 1.69 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 28.25 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 34.06 percent of the residents in 20106 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.38 members with about 2.49 cars available per household.
An estimate of 90.55 percent of the residents in 20106 has some form of health insurance. 37.40 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 73.35 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 20106 would have to travel an average of 27.47 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Novant Prince William Medical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 20106, Amissville, Virginia.

As of , an estimate of 4,476 residents live in 20106 with a median age of 47.8 years. 22.21 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 24.82 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 42.02 percent of the residents in 20106 is currently married, and 16.92 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 20106 is $7,697.58.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 20106 is approximately $1,414. The median household spends about 18.37 percent of their income on housing.
